Introduction

Rapid advances in data collection and storage technology have enabled or

ganizations to accumulate vast amounts of data. However, extracting useful

information has proven extremely challenging. Often, traditional data analy

sis tools and techniques cannot be used because of the massive size of a data

set. Sometimes, the non-traditional nature of the data means that traditional

approaches cannot be applied even if the data set is relatively small. In other

situations, the questions that need to be answered cannot be addressed using

existing data analysis techniques, and thus, new methods need to be devel

oped.

Data mining is a technology that blends traditional data analysis methods

with sophisticated algorithms for processing large volumes of data. It has also

opened up exciting opportunities for exploring and analyzing new types of

data and for analyzing old types of data in new ways. In this introductory

chapter, we present an overview of data mining and outline the key topics

to be covered in this book. We start with a description of some well-known

applications that require new techniques for data analysis.

Business Point-of-sale data collection (bar code scanners, radio frequency

identification (RFID), and smart card technology) have allowed retailers to

collect up-to-the-minute data about customer purchases at the checkout coun

ters of their stores. Retailers can utilize this information, along with other

business-critical data such as Web logs from e-commerce Web sites and cus

tomer service records from call centers, to help them better understand the

needs of their customers and make more informed business decisions.
